Our One Day #WithoutShoes
Today the Collective Bias team and Social Fabric® community are joining together in One Day #WithoutShoes. This global movement has been inspired by TOMS, a shoe company known for its One for One Model and impressive mobilization of people aligned with its mission. Similarly, the goal of this One Day is to drive further awareness of the reality that millions of children in the world lack this basic resource: shoes.
